From 63264ac23f3b9cfaa725cf90d995497ba1601449 Mon Sep 17 00:00:00 2001 From: Stenzek Date: Sat, 28 Nov 2015 21:33:47 +1000 Subject: D3D: Fix EFB depth buffer copies, filtering on scaled EFB copies when MSAA is enabled, real XFB filtering Since ResolveSubresource cannot be used with depth textures (and throws an error with the debug layer enabled), use a shader which selects the minimum depth value from all samples.
